Cell towers typically use valve-regulated lead-acid (VRLA) batteries, flooded lead-acid, and increasingly lithium-ion batteries. VRLA batteries dominate due to their sealed design and low maintenance. Standard telecom batteries range from 19-inch rack-mounted units (500-800mm tall) to modular cabinets (2,000mm x 800mm). Lead-acid batteries typically occupy 30% more space than lithium-ion equivalents.
